    Real World Studios: The Mansion and Recording Complex

    The Birth of Real World Studios

    In the late 1980s, Peter Gabriel envisioned a space where musicians could come together, collaborate, and create something extraordinary. This dream led to the establishment of Real World Studios, situated near Bath, England, in the picturesque village of Box. The property, a historic sawmill dating back over 200 years, was transformed into a world-class recording complex while preserving its rustic charm.

    A Blend of Old and New

    The appeal of Real World Studios lies in its perfect blend of house history and modernity. Gabriel retained the sawmill’s original structure while incorporating cutting-edge technology and a unique architectural design. The concept was to create a space that fosters creativity by harmonizing with nature, emphasizing water, light, and interconnectedness.

    Key Features of the Mansion and Studios

    1. The Big Room
    2. The centerpiece of Real World Studios, The Big Room, is a massive, open recording space with floor-to-ceiling glass walls that overlook a millpond. It’s famous for its incredible acoustics and inspiring views, making it a favorite among artists.
    3. Writing Room and Work Room
    4. These are Peter Gabriel’s personal creative spaces. Designed for privacy and focus, these rooms are where Gabriel has crafted some of his most iconic music.
    5. The Production Room
    6. Equipped with state-of-the-art technology, this room is ideal for producers and engineers. It combines functionality with a cozy atmosphere.
    7. The Producer’s Cottage
    8. A separate building on the property, this cottage provides lodging for producers and artists, allowing them to immerse themselves in the creative process without distractions.

    A Creative Atmosphere

    What sets Real World Studios apart is its atmosphere. Surrounded by nature, with water flowing through the house property, the space is designed to inspire. The large windows bring in natural light, and the open-plan studios encourage collaboration among artists. Over the years, the studio has been upgraded with new equipment while retaining its unique charm.

    Woolley Valley Retreat: Peter Gabriel’s Private Haven

    Peter Gabriel House

    A Countryside Escape

    Just a short distance from Real World Studios lies Woolley Valley, a tranquil retreat where Gabriel finds solace. Nestled in the English countryside, this property is a stark contrast to the bustling recording studios. Surrounded by rolling hills, lush greenery, and serene landscapes, Woolley Valley provides the perfect environment for relaxation and introspection.

    A Sanctuary for Creativity

    For Gabriel, Woolley Valley is more than just a home—it’s a sanctuary. The property is designed to complement his artistic lifestyle, offering peace and inspiration. Whether it’s walking through the fields, enjoying nature, or simply finding quiet moments, Woolley Valley helps Gabriel reconnect with himself.
